Leicester City have been docked six points by the English Football League for breaching financial rules. The deduction will be applied immediately meaning the Foxes fall from 17th to 20th in the Championship and are only outside the relegation zone on goal difference. Sheffield Wednesday’s administrators have said the club has enough money to get through to the end of the season. The Championship outfit were placed in administration in October and a preferred bidder was appointed in December. A man has been banned from driving for six months after crashing his supercar into a motorhome on the A12 in Suffolk.
